English > legion: 5 senses > adjective 1
MeaningAmounting to a large indefinite number.
Example "Palomar's fans are legion"
Synonymnumerous
BroadermanyA quantifier that can be used with count nouns and is often preceded by 'as' or 'too' or 'so' or 'that'

English > legion: 5 senses > noun 1, group
MeaningArchaic terms for army.
Synonymhost
NarrowerRoman LegionA division of from 3000 to 6000 men (including cavalry) in the Roman army
Sabaoth(plural) hosts or armies
Broaderarmy, regular army, ground forcesA permanent organization of the military land forces of a nation or state

English > legion: 5 senses > noun 3, group
MeaningA large military unit.
Example"the French Foreign Legion"
Memberslegionnaire, legionaryA soldier who is a member of a legion (especially the French Foreign Legion)
Narrowerforeign legionA military unit composed of foreign volunteers who serve the state
Broadermilitary unit, military force, military group, forceA unit that is part of some military service
